Incidence and risk factors for complications after definitive skeletal fixation of lower extremity in multiple injury patients: a retrospective chart review [version 1; referees: 2 approved]
Background: The management of multiple injuries is complex. Type and timing of treatment for lower extremity fractures is a controversial subject.
